Abstract:
We propose an optimization model and its corresponding parallel algorithm for optimized signal-planning. Based on a local enumeration method, the algorithm adds a virtual guiding penalty, which is derived from the traffic weight. This makes the algorithm has a global spatial and temporal optimized property. In the situation of saturated or over-saturated traffic status, this algorithm outperforms the traditional single-point intersection control method.
Key words: neural network, signal timing optimization, dynamictraffic weight, parallel algorithm
